  • New Research By Acuiti And Eventus Reveals Increase In Regulatory Requirements, Trading Environment Complexities Drives Investment In Trade Surveillance

    Date 29/11/2022

    The increasing complexity of trade surveillance requirements, driven by regulatory demands and exacerbated by volatility, is putting pressure on manual processes and driving investment in automation, a new study by Acuiti has found. 

  • CPMI And IOSCO Report On Financial Market Infrastructures' Cyber Resilience Finds Reasonably High Adoption Of Cyber Guidance But Highlights One Serious Issue Of Concern And Four Issues Of Concern

    Date 29/11/2022

    • The report finds reasonably high adoption of the Guidance on cyber resilience for financial market infrastructures (“Cyber Guidance”) by FMIs.
    • The report finds one serious issue of concern and four issues of concern. The serious issue of concern relates to a small number of FMIs not fully meeting expectations regarding the development of cyber response and recovery plans to meet the two-hour recovery time objective (2hRTO). The four additional issues of concern relate to shortcomings in established response and recovery plans to meet the 2hRTO under extreme cyber-attack scenarios; lack of cyber resilience testing after major system changes; lack of comprehensive scenario-based testing; and inadequate involvement of relevant stakeholders in testing.
    • These findings highlight clear challenges for FMIs’ cyber resilience that should be addressed with the highest priority.

  • Borsa Istanbul : “OIC/COMCEC International Investment Fund” Panel Has Been Held

    Date 29/11/2022

    Within the scope of the 38th Ministerial Session of COMCEC, a panel on the “OIC/COMCEC International Investment Fund”, which was established on November 29th, 2022 in order to strengthen the capital markets of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) was held. In the panel, an overview of OIC capital markets, the importance and challenges of OIC capital markets, digitalization and digital assets, the investment criteria of the Islamic Development Bank (IsDB), as well as challenges faced and solutions provided during the establishment of the Fund, the investment opportunities it offers, its sustainability, how it can contribute to the OIC capital markets were discussed. OIC national delegations, OIC financial institutions, investors, relevant experts and academics participated in the panel.
